My childhood was plagued by abuse, both physical and emotional, leaving scars that would take years to heal. Yet, amidst the darkness, I found a flicker of hope in an unexpected place-writing poetry. Each line I penned became a way to make sense of my experiences. Poetry wasn't just an outlet; it was my lifeline. Through words, I could express the pain and confusion that filled my young heart. I poured my soul onto the pages, turning my trauma into art. Writing lifted me, allowing me to escape the chaos and create a world where I had control. As I grew older, that passion for writing became intertwined with my desire to help others. I realized that my journey didn't end with my personal healing; it could lead me to a profession where I could make a difference in the lives of others. Now, I'm on my way to college to study psychology. My goal is to work with those who, like me, have faced overwhelming struggles. I want to give them the support and understanding that I yearned for during my toughest days. The road ahead won't always be easy, but I carry with me the strength that comes from surviving my past. I believe that by combining my love for poetry with my education in psychology, I can help others find their voices and healing.
